517 /* Determine whether INSN is MEM store pattern that we will consider moving.
518 REGS_SET_BEFORE is bitmap of registers set before (and including) the
519 current insn, REGS_SET_AFTER is bitmap of registers set after (and
520 including) the insn in this basic block. We must be passing through BB from
521 head to end, as we are using this fact to speed things up.
523 The results are stored this way:
525 -- the first anticipatable expression is added into ANTIC_STORES
526 -- if the processed expression is not anticipatable, NULL_RTX is added
527 there instead, so that we can use it as indicator that no further
528 expression of this type may be anticipatable
529 -- if the expression is available, it is added as head of AVAIL_STORES;
530 consequently, all of them but this head are dead and may be deleted.
531 -- if the expression is not available, the insn due to that it fails to be
532 available is stored in REACHING_REG (via LAST_AVAIL_CHECK_FAILURE).
534 The things are complicated a bit by fact that there already may be stores
535 to the same MEM from other blocks; also caller must take care of the
536 necessary cleanup of the temporary markers after end of the basic block.
